India vs Afghanistan ODI series has been one-sided as the Men in Blue have already sealed the three-match series by winning the first two ODIs by 7 wickets and 170 runs, respectively. The third ODI is set to be played at the MA Chidambaram Stadium, Chennai, on Saturday, June 20.

The match is expected to be a dead rubber one; however, India would like to keep their momentum up and whitewash the Afghans before they travel for their next ODI assignment in England.

India vs Afghanistan 3rd ODI Pitch & Weather Report

The pitch for the clash will offer spin and grip like a typical Chennai wicket for an ODI match. Teams have won chasing 20 matches, but the pitch tends to play slow as the game goes on.

As per the weather updates, there is a chance of rain, with a 57% chance of precipitation. The highest temperature is expected to reach 34.6°C, while the lowest might be 28.1°C. So if it rains early, the team winning the toss would like to use the seaming conditions.

India vs Afghanistan 3rd ODI Head-to-Head Record

The two teams have met six times, with India winning five matches and one match ending in a tie, which was back in the Asia Cup 2018. Afghanistan have given some fight but has failed to hold their temper in this format.

India vs Afghanistan 3rd ODI Toss Prediction

The venue has hosted 39 ODI fixtures, 18 of which were won by the team batting first, while the chasing side won on 20 occasions. However, chasing under lights has been easier, but as predicted, teams would like to bowl first to get some movement.

India vs Afghanistan 3rd ODI Score Prediction

If India bat first, a total between 250 and 275 would be a good score, keeping in mind the sluggish nature of the pitch. If Afghanistan bat first, they will aim for a score of around 220 to 250, which could prove challenging to chase at this venue.
